What is Portex Minerals Debt-to-EBITDA?

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

Portex Minerals's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2016 was $0.02 Mil. Portex Minerals's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2016 was $0.00 Mil. Portex Minerals's annualized E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2016 was $0.00 Mil.

A high Debt-to-EBITDA ratio generally means that a company may spend more time to paying off its debt. According to Joel Tillinghast's BIG MONEY THINKS SMALL: Biases, Blind Spots, and Smarter Investing, a ratio of Debt-to-EBITDA exceeding four is usually considered scary unless tangible assets cover the debt.

Portex Minerals Debt-to-EBITDA Calculation

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

Portex Minerals's Debt-to-EBITDA for the fiscal year that ended in Sep. 2015 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(0.019 + 0) / -1.129
=-0.02

Portex Minerals Business Description

Address 2 Bloor Street West, Suite 2000, Toronto, ON, CAN, M4W 3E2
Portex Minerals Inc is a mineral exploration and development company focused on the acquisition and development of mining projects in Europe and other low-risk jurisdictions.
